Safety instructions 2 Safety instructions Intended use This device is designed for sound reinforcement. Use the device only as described in this user manual. Any other use or use under other operating conditions is considered to be improper and may result in personal injury or property damage. No liability will be assumed for damages resulting from improper use.
Safety instructions DANGER! Electric shock caused by high voltages inside Within the device there are areas where high voltages may be present. Never remove any covers. There are no user-serviceable parts inside. Do not use the device if covers, protectors or optical components are missing or damaged. DANGER! Electric shock caused by short-circuit Always use proper ready-made insulated mains cabling (power cord) with a pro‐ tective contact plug. Do not modify the mains cable or the plug.
Safety instructions CAUTION! Possible hearing damage The device can produce volume levels that may cause temporary or permanent hearing impairment. Over an extended period of time, even levels that seem to be uncritical can cause hearing damage. Decrease the volume level immediately if you experience ringing in your ears or hearing impairment. If this is not possible, keep a greater distance or use suffi‐ cient ear protectors. NOTICE! Risk of fire Do not block areas of ventilation.
Safety instructions NOTICE! Operating conditions This device has been designed for indoor use only. To prevent damage, never expose the device to any liquid or moisture. Avoid direct sunlight, heavy dirt, and strong vibrations. NOTICE! Power supply Before connecting the device, ensure that the input voltage (AC outlet) matches the voltage rating of the device and that the AC outlet is protected by a residual current circuit breaker.
Safety instructions NOTICE! Possible damage due to installation of a wrong fuse The use of different types of fuses can cause serious damage to the unit. Fire hazard! Only fuses of the same type may be used.
Features 3 Features Special features of the device: n Inputs: XLR and 1/4" phone sockets, RCA sockets (CL 115 and CL 118) n Outputs: NL4 chassis connectors for passive speaker boxes (top), DIRECT OUT (CL 115 and CL 118) n 36 mm pole mount flange n Butterfly handles n Transport casters n PU coating n Protective cover optionally available CL 112 / CL 115 / CL 118 SUB MKII 13
Installation 4 Installation Unpack and check carefully there is no transportation damage before using the unit. Keep the equipment packaging. To fully protect the product against vibration, dust and moisture during transportation or storage use the original packaging or your own packaging material suitable for transport or storage, respectively. For operation, the device must be placed on the rubber feet over the side provided with a pro‐ tective edge.
Installation CAUTION! Risk of injury due to heavy weight Due to the heavy weight of the device, at least two persons are required for trans‐ port and installation. NOTICE! Possible property damage by magnetic fields Loudspeakers produce a static magnetic field. Therefore, maintain an appropriate distance to devices that can be adversely affected or damaged by an external magnetic field.
Installation 4.1 Tips on handling speakers We recommend you to set up the speakers in a way, that the sound signals can reach the audi‐ ence unobstructedly. It will often be helpful to mount the speakers on tripods. Thus, the sound will be evenly spread with maximum range throughout the audience area. Always use high grade cable to connect your equipment. Otherwise you won't reach max‐ imum sound quality.

Connections and operating elements 1 Mains switch [POWER] Turns the device on and off. 2 IEC chassis plug with fuse holder for the power supply. 3 [SAT POWER OUT RIGHT | LEFT] Speaker outputs (Speaker Twist panel connectors). 4 [INPUT RIGHT | LEFT] Inputs for balanced or unbalanced line level signals (XLR sockets). 5 [INPUT RIGHT | LEFT] Inputs for balanced or unbalanced line level signals (RCA sockets). 6 [POWER] This LED indicates that the device is switched on and operational.
Connections and operating elements 8 [SUB PHASE] This slide switch can be used to reverse the phasing (0 ° / 180 °). This avoids unwanted cancellation effects in combi‐ nation with other speakers. 9 [MAIN LEVEL] This rotary control can be used to adjust the overall volume (subwoofer and connected external speakers). 10 [PROTECT] This LED lights up red when the unit switches to protection mode. In this case, check the cables for short circuit or bad connection.
